The expense ratio is 0.11%.To calculate your own rate of interest that you'd get to keep for the fund, you'd subtract your marginal tax rate from 1.0, then multiply that number times the SEC 7 day yield. ( 1.0 - 0.22) X 4.33% = 3.3774%. So, 3.3774% is the interest you'd actually get to keep by investing in VUSXX, if you're in the 22% Federal bracket.

The Fidelity Government Money Market Fund (SPAXX) has $270 billion in total assets and an expense ratio of 0.42%. This means this fund generates roughly $1+ Billion of revenue for Fidelity every year. Meanwhile, the Vanguard Federal Money Market Fund (VMFXX) is nearly the same size at $250 billion of total assets, but only a 0.11% expense ratio.

For the Vanguard Federal Money Market Fund, this percentage was 37.79% in 2022. Therefore, if you earned $1,000 in total interest from VMFXX in 2022, then $377.90 was exempt from state and local income taxes.
